Bluffton Regulations

STRs are explicitly allowed and the permitting process is clear and timely, but the one-unit-per-lot cap and limited zoning coverage materially constrain investor flexibility. Significant annual fees ($325 STR permit + $50 business license, plus taxes and recurring obligations) and tight operational requirements (24/7 availability, 1-hour response, quiet hours, safety equipment) increase compliance burden.

About Bluffton

Bluffton, South Carolina, is a quaint and picturesque town located in the Lowcountry region. With a population of approximately 28,000 residents, this charming town is situated just 12 miles west of the popular tourist destination of Hilton Head Island and about 20 miles northeast of Savannah, Georgia. Bluffton’s proximity to these major cities makes it an attractive spot for short-term rentals.

Bluffton is known for its rich history, scenic views, and vibrant arts community, making it appealing for visitors. Prominent landmarks include the historic Church of the Cross web link: [https://www.thechurchofthecross.net/], a beautiful Episcopal church dating back to 1857, and the Heyward House Museum and Welcome Center web link: [https://www.heywardhouse.org/], which offers insights into the town’s antebellum past. Additionally, the Bluffton Oyster Co. web link: [https://blufftonoyster.com/], South Carolina’s oldest continuously operating oyster shucking facility, provides a glimpse into the local seafood industry.

The town's Old Town district is a focal point for tourists, encompassing charming boutiques, art galleries, and an array of dining options that offer a taste of Lowcountry cuisine. For outdoor enthusiasts, the May River, which runs through Bluffton, offers various recreational activities such as boating, fishing, and kayaking.

Bluffton’s mild climate, combined with its blend of historic charm and modern amenities, positions it as a desirable location for short-term rental properties. The town's unique mix of cultural attractions and natural beauty ensures a memorable stay for visitors, making it an appealing choice for both short-term renters and property investors alike.
